Common StartUpManager.exe Errors on Windows

Dealing with StartUpManager.exe errors can often be perplexing, given the variety of issues that might cause them. They can range from a mere software glitch to a more serious malware intrusion. Here, we've compiled a list of the most common errors associated with StartUpManager.exe to help you navigate and possibly fix these issues.

  • Insufficient System Resources Exist to Complete the Requested Service: This error arises when your system runs low on resources. It could be due to running too many programs simultaneously or because of a memory leak in the software.
  • Not a Valid Win32 Application: This error message signifies that the program is incompatible with the Windows version in use, or the program file could be damaged.
  • Application Not Found: This message occurs when the system can't find the necessary application. Possible reasons could be the application being deleted, moved, or an inaccurately specified file path.
  • StartUpManager.exe - Bad Image Error:: This alert is displayed when Windows fails to execute StartUpManager.exe due to its corruption, or the related DLL file being absent or damaged.
  • Access is Denied: This error usually comes up due to permission issues. It indicates that the user does not have the necessary rights to execute a certain .exe file.
